This is the administration system for the Oxfordshire Acro Society. It is the code that runs https://www.oxfordshireacrosociety.co.uk/.
- Authentication: Secure user registration, login, and password recovery.
- Roles & Permissions: Support for Administrators, Reviewers, and Standard Members.
- Profile Management: Admins can manage members details.
- Membership Status: Tracking of active/inactive members and honorary statuses.
- Event Scheduling: Administrators can schedule training sessions and jams.
- Booking System: Members can book upcoming sessions.
- book in via nfc or qr code: Attendees can book in via nfc tag or qr code.
- Attendance Tracking: Track attendance for each event.
- Analysis: Reports and graphs of attendance data.
- Open Banking Integration (Gocardless): Automatically pull transactions and link with members.
- Financial Reporting: Generate reports on income, expenses, and member balances.
- Credits: Management and tracking of members credits.
- Credit Expiry: Credits can be configured to expire after a certain period.
- Credit Transfer: Admins can transfer users credits to other users.
- Financial Analysis: Generate reports and graphs of financial data.
- Chat: Provides members communication with an Admin or AI assistant.
- AI tools: Members can book in or query their credit balance through the chat interface.
- Notifications Members will recieve emails notifactions about their credit balance and booking vigilance.
- Administration: Admins can administer everything.
- Reviewers: Reviewers can monitor data.
- Backups: Daily database snapshots with configurable offsite transfer.
- Content Management: Admins can manage content.

Initialize the database: mix ecto.create
Run the migrations: mix ecto.migrate
Start the server: iex -S mix phx.server
Start the admin ui cd oas-web && npm run start && cd ../
Start the public ui cd oas-web-public && npm run start && cd ../
To setup an admin user, register through the UI then reset your password. In the dev environment, the reset email will be available at /dev/mailbox. Open the sqlite database manually and set is_admin to true for that user.
